Stem cells offer regenerative medicine potential but face challenges like ethical concerns and technical hurdles. Research is advancing radio-labeled stem cell tracking for improved medical therapies.

Area of Science:

  • Regenerative Medicine
  • Cell Biology
  • Medical Imaging

Background:

  • Stem cells (SC) are self-renewing cells with therapeutic potential for various diseases.
  • Embryonic stem (ES) cells offer significant developmental potential but face ethical and technical challenges.
  • Adult stem cells are rare and have limited proliferative capacity compared to ES cells.

Purpose of the Study:

  • To summarize progress and limitations in stem cell utilization.
  • To raise awareness of stem cell research within the ISORBE community.
  • To foster knowledge exchange on radiolabeled stem cells.

Main Methods:

  • Review of stem cell properties and therapeutic applications.
  • Discussion of limitations including ethical issues, carcinogenesis risk, and technical challenges.

  • Overview of current and potential imaging techniques for stem cell tracking, including PET.
  • Main Results:

    • Hematopoietic stem cell transplants are established therapies.
    • Pluripotent stem cells show promise for treating numerous diseases.
    • Advancements in imaging agents like 18F-FDG and 64Cu-Pyruvaldehyde bi(N4-methylthiosemicarbazone) are being studied for PET imaging.

    Conclusions:

    • Stem cell research presents significant opportunities for medical therapies.
    • Overcoming technical and ethical challenges is crucial for widespread stem cell application.
    • Improved imaging techniques are essential for effective stem cell therapy monitoring.
